Understanding Reverse Mortgages in 75838, Texas

Reverse mortgages offer a valuable financial tool for seniors in the 75838 zip code area of Texas, allowing homeowners aged 62 and older to tap into their home equity without the burden of monthly mortgage payments. Unlike traditional mortgages where you make payments to the lender, a reverse mortgage provides cash to the borrower, with the loan balance repaid when the home is sold or the borrower passes away. This can be particularly beneficial for retirees in 75838 Zip Code, texas, helping cover living expenses, medical costs, or other needs while staying in their homes.

In Texas, reverse mortgages are federally insured through the Home Equity Conversion Mortgage (HECM) program, administered by the U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D). To qualify, you must be at least 62 years old, own your home outright or have a low remaining mortgage balance, and use the property as your primary residence. Texas state regulations add specific protections, such as requiring counseling from a HUD-approved agency to ensure you understand the implications, including how the loan reduces your home equity over time and potential impacts on heirs. Financial assessments are also conducted to confirm your ability to cover property taxes, insurance, and maintenance—essential requirements to avoid default.

Benefits of Reverse Mortgages for Elderly Homeowners

Reverse mortgages offer significant advantages for elderly homeowners in the 75838 zip code, Texas, providing financial flexibility without the burden of monthly repayments. One key benefit is receiving tax-free proceeds, which can be used freely to enhance retirement living. Summit Lending specializes in these solutions tailored to the local community.

Flexible payout options make reverse mortgages highly adaptable. Homeowners can choose a lump sum for immediate needs, establish a line of credit for ongoing access, or opt for monthly payments to supplement income. Loan Options and Costs Associated

The primary reverse mortgage product available is the Home Equity Conversion Mortgage (HECM), insured by the Federal Housing Administration (FHA). HECMs allow homeowners aged 62 and older to convert home equity into cash via lump sum, monthly payments, line of credit, or a combination. For Texas residents in areas like Donie or Freestone County, HECMs offer flexibility to cover living expenses, medical costs, or home improvements while you continue to live in your home.

Other options may include proprietary reverse mortgages from private lenders, which can provide higher loan amounts for high-value homes but come with varying terms. We also offer reverse loans customized to your needs, whether you're exploring options alongside purchase loans or refinance loans.

Costs associated with reverse mortgages include origination fees (typically 2% of the home value for the first $200,000 and 1% thereafter, capped at $6,000), closing costs similar to traditional mortgages, and an upfront FHA mortgage insurance premium (2% of the loan amount). Annual mortgage insurance premiums are about 0.5% of the loan balance. Interest rates are usually variable, tied to indices like the LIBOR or Treasury rates, currently averaging around 5-7% for HECMs, though fixed-rate options exist for lump-sum payouts.

The loan balance grows over time as interest and fees accrue on the borrowed amount, reducing available equity. For example, if you take a $100,000 line of credit at 6% interest, the balance could grow to approximately $106,000 after one year, plus fees. This is why it's crucial to borrow only what you need. Risks and Considerations for Reverse Loans

While reverse mortgage loans can provide valuable financial support for seniors in the 75838 Zip Code, Texas, it's essential to weigh the potential risks and considerations before proceeding. At Summit Lending, we prioritize educating our clients on these aspects to ensure informed decisions.

One significant downside is the impact on inheritance. Reverse loans accrue interest over time, which can substantially increase the loan balance. This means heirs may receive a reduced inheritance or even face the responsibility of repaying the loan if the home's value doesn't cover the outstanding amount. Additionally, reverse loans come with the obligation to repay the full amount if you move out of the home, sell it, or pass away. This can limit your flexibility, especially if health changes require relocation to a care facility. It's crucial to discuss these terms with experienced loan officers who can guide you through the process.

In Texas, understanding the effect on Medicaid eligibility is particularly important. Reverse loans are considered loans rather than income, but they can influence asset calculations and long-term care benefits. We recommend consulting with a financial advisor or reviewing state-specific guidelines to avoid unintended consequences on your eligibility.
